Olga Nikolayevna Yepifanova (Russian:О́льга Никола́евна Епифа́нова; born 19 August 1966) is a Russian politician who served asDeputy Chairman of theState Duma in 2016–2020. She has served as a deputy of the State Duma since 2011.
Olga Nikolaevna Yepifanova was born on 19 August 1966 inNovgorod,Russian SFSR,Soviet Union.[1][2]
